Frequently Asked Questions about Cleveland

How much are Studio apartments in Cleveland?

There are currently 638 Studio Apartments in Cleveland with rent ranges from $603 to $2,900 with an average price of $1,240.

What is the current price range for One Bedroom Cleveland Apartments for rent?

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Cleveland ranges from $419 to $6,000 with an average monthly rent of $1,599.

What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Cleveland cost?

The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Cleveland range from $490 to $6,750.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,774.

How expensive are Cleveland Three Bedroom Apartments?

There are currently 540 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Cleveland on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$554 to $10,968 - averaging $1,930 for the location.
